Founder of failed crypto lending platform Celsius Network arrested on fraud charges

Por: ABC News Tech July 13, 2023

thumbnail

NEW YORK -- The founder and former CEO of the failed cryptocurrency lending platform Celsius Network was freed on $40 million bail Thursday after pleading not guilty to federal fraud charges alleging that he schemed to defraud customers by misleading them about key aspects of the business.Alexander Mashinsky, 57, of Manhattan, was charged with securities, commodities and wire fraud in an indictment unsealed in Manhattan federal court.
